Ladywell Station is bustling with activity, providing facilities aimed at making your experience as seamless as possible. You’ll find ticket machines located on the station forecourt, with accessible machines to ease your travel preparations. Whether you're collecting tickets bought online or validate your smartcards, the station ensures an effortless start to your journey. However, do note that the ticket office is only open from 06:10 till 19:30 on weekdays and shorter hours on Saturdays.
While the station does not feature toilets or waiting rooms, it remains user-friendly for those with accessibility needs. Step-free access is available to some platforms via ramps, making it friendlier for those with disabilities. For your comfort, there’s a seating area on-site. And if you're a cyclist, there are eight sheltered bicycle stands located at Platform 1, providing a secure space to leave your bike while you travel.
Making your way around London is seamless from Ladywell Station. For those needing a rail replacement service, buses towards Lewisham and Hayes are readily available just off Ladywell Road. When it comes to purchasing tickets at West Worthing, travelers enjoy the convenience of a ticket office with ample opening hours, operating from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ays, slightly extended on Saturdays, and reduced hours on Sundays. For those who prefer a more digital approach, ticket machines are on hand and ready to assist, including facilities for collecting pre-purchased tickets. The station also supports Southern's smartcard system, with both issuing and validating capabilities available.
Step-free access is another highlight here, meeting the needs of passengers requiring additional support. The station's essential facilities, such as staff-operated ramps, make it accessible. It's worth noting though that waiting rooms are absent, but there are seating areas available. While there's no provision for luggage storage or accessible toilets, the station does maintain CCTV for added security.
Refreshment choices are somewhat limited, yet there's a refreshment facility available to grab a quick bite. Those needing cash would need to plan ahead, as there are no ATM facilities onsite.
For those relying on public transport beyond the rail, the station is well-connected. While there's no dedicated bus stop directly at the station, accessible taxi services can be found on Tarring Road. Convenient rail replacement services also operate when necessary, with details on bus locations provided as needed. The central location of the station ensures efficient links to local buses and coaches, aiding in onward travel plans.
